How to improve payment approval - VTEX - Mercado Pago Developers
Which documentation are you looking for?

Do not know how to start integrating? 

Check the first steps

How to improve payments approval

When making an online payment, the transaction undergoes a careful analysis to minimize fraud risks and ensure that processing takes place without errors.

In this documentation, you will find information about what causes a payment to be declined and some recommendations to prevent this from happening.

Why is a payment order rejected?

A payment may be declined due to an issue with the payment method or because it does not meet the necessary security requirements. For example, if the card does not have enough amount or if there is a strange movement of the account.

Reasons for refusal

Payment refusal is a reality in the world of online sales and can happen for several reasons: incorrect filling of information by the customer, attempted fraud, problem in communication between acquirers, among many other issues.

Important
You can also find more information about payments in the Mercado Pago account activity.

Recommendations to improve your approval

To prevent a legitimate payment from being refused because it does not meet security validations, it is necessary to include all possible information when carrying out the transaction. Furthermore, you must pay attention to some security requirements, such as our Security Code and Device ID.

Important
If you use Checkout Pro, you already implement our security methods to prevent fraud.

Implement the Device ID in your site

The Device ID is an important piece of information to ensure better security and, consequently, a better payment approval rate. It's a unique number that's used to identify a customer's device when they are buying.

If a customer makes a purchase on a different device than usual, this may mean that the purchase was fake and should not be done.

Check if the store is sending this information and if not, make sure to activate this feature.